Charles Criner was born in 1945 in Athens, Texas, a small town near Tyler. Criner’s childhood artistic training consisted merely of attempts to copy images from Walter Foster Art books. In spite of Criner's lack of training, the young man’s eyes were opened to the possibility of an artistic career at an early age.
